About Manager, Software Development Engineer in Test (Voyager Health Care)

  The SDET Manager will play a key role in Product Delivery for the Voyager Health platform, which is bespoke development of a Practice Management System within MARS Veterinary Health. This role will lead and manage the performance of the SDET team, provide release coordination and support production issues. The SDET Manager will help implement and manage various automated and manual regression testing suites. In this role, the SDET Manager will work closely with functional QA, UAT teams, and business partners to ensure that all facets of automated testing are covered and successful.
